Abstract

An enclosed hose reel 10 consists of a spool 12 and two enclosure halves 14 comprising the frame 16. The power spring 18 is contained in the spool 12. Tension on the power spring 18 is transmitted to the frame 16 via a shaft 20 with a spring 30 loaded ratchet 22. The ratchet mechanism 24 engages the frame 16 via protrusions 26 that fit into cutouts 28 within the enclosure 14. The protrusions 26 and cutouts 28 are designed so that a clockwise rotation is allowed to increase the tension of the power spring 18.

Description of the Invention: [Technical Field of the Invention] This application claims the benefit of US Patent Application No. 61/2 56,224, filed on Oct. 29, 2009. Break into this case for reference. [Prior Art] A spring loaded hose reel for retractably storing air and fluid hoses is well known. The design requirements of the prior art technique are to maintain the torque on the hub with a wrench when removing and replacing the necessary fasteners. SUMMARY OF THE INVENTION A closed hose reel includes a spool and two half-shells that include a bracket. The power spring is contained within the reel. The tension on the power spring is transmitted to the bracket via the shaft, which has a spring loaded ratchet. The ratchet mechanism engages the brackets via the projections that fit into the recesses in the housing. Designing the projections and recesses allows the clockwise rotation to increase the tension of the power spring. The ratchet is spring loaded to allow axial movement of the ratchet to step into a clockwise position below the ratchet. The ratchet has a hexagonal and inner square drive socket that is exposed to the outside. To increase the spring tension, the user simply turns the ratchet in a clockwise direction using a wrench or socket wrench. To increase the spring tension, the user must apply a torque to the wrench or socket wrench, push the ratchet in, then turn the ratchet counterclockwise while allowing the ratchet to move outward to engage the next counterclockwise position. S. -5- 201135098 The present invention is capable of adjusting the hose reel spring with one hand and allowing the hose reel spring to be adjusted in a safer manner. [Embodiment] The closed hose reel 10 includes a reel 12 and two half-shells 14 including brackets 16. A power spring 18 is contained within the spool 12. The tension on the force spring 18 is transmitted to the bracket 16 via the shaft 20, which has a spring 30 loading the ratchet 22. The ratchet mechanism 24 engages the bracket 16 via the projections 26 that fit into the recesses 28 in the housing 14. The convex portion 26 and the recess portion 28 are designed such that clockwise rotation increases the tension of the power spring 18. The ratchet 22 is loaded by the spring 30 to allow axial movement of the ratchet 22 to ride into a clockwise position below the ratchet 22. The ratchet 22 has a hexagonal shape 32 exposed to the outside and an inner square drive socket 34. To increase the spring tension, the user simply uses a wrench or socket wrench to simply rotate the ratchet 22 in a clockwise direction. To increase the spring tension, the user must apply a torque to the wrench or socket wrench, push the ratchet 22 in, and then rotate the ratchet 22 counterclockwise while allowing the ratchet 22 to move outwardly to engage the next counterclockwise position.
